Abscisic acid signals reorientation of polyamine metabolism to orchestrate stress responses via the polyamine exodus pathway in grapevine.
Journal of plant physiology - 1 May 2010
Toumi Imene, Moschou Panagiotis N, Paschalidis Konstantinos A, Bouamama Badra, Ben Salem-Fnayou Asma, Ghorbel Abdel Wahed, Mliki Ahmed, Roubelakis-Angelakis Kalliopi A
Abstract excerpt
Polyamines (PAs) have been suggested to be implicated in plant responses to abiotic and biotic stress. Grapevine is a model perennial plant species whose cultivars respond differently to osmotic stress. In this study, we used two cultivars, one sensitive (S) and one tolerant (T) to drought. In adult vines subjected to drought under greenhouse conditions, total PAs were significantly lower in the control T- and...
